如何在Linux下高效配置服务器?
创始人
2024-11-06 22:12:24
Linux服务器配置涉及多个方面,包括网络设置、安全策略实施、服务管理等。使用Linux下的配置工具可以高效地进行这些操作,确保服务器稳定运行并满足业务需求。

在Linux系统中配置服务器是IT管理工作的重要组成部分,涉及到从硬件选择到软件配置的多个方面,本文将详细解析如何在Linux环境下进行服务器的配置,确保服务器可以高效、安全地运行各种应用程序和服务。

如何在Linux下高效配置服务器?(图片来源网络,侵删)

确认服务器的硬件条件是否满足需求至关重要,这包括选择合适的CPU、足够的内存和大容量的存储设备,对于运行密集型应用如数据分析或机器学习的服务器,高性能的GPU也是不可或缺的,确保硬件资源符合应用需求,可以为后续的软件配置和优化提供良好的基础。

安装和配置Linux操作系统是核心步骤,常见的Linux发行版如Ubuntu和CentOS因其稳定性和安全性广受青睐,在安装系统时,需要对软件包、网络设置、时区等进行准确配置,确保系统的基本功能正常运行,配置网络是服务器搭建的重要环节,包括确保服务器能够访问互联网,配置DNS解析和时间同步服务NTP,以及设置防火墙规则以保护服务器安全。

随后,根据服务器的用途安装必要的软件,如果服务器用于运行Python Web应用,可以安装Anaconda来管理不同的Python环境和包,配置PyTorch和CUDA可以提升深度学习应用的处理速度,确保所有软件包都是从官方或可靠的源安装,可以避免潜在的安全风险。

服务器的日常维护和监控也非常重要,这包括定期更新系统和应用软件,监控系统的运行状态,以及备份重要数据,使用如Nagios或Zabbix等监控工具能够帮助管理员及时发现并解决可能出现的问题,从而确保服务的持续性和数据的安全。

通过虚拟机软件或云服务部署Linux服务器也是一种常见的做法,虽然这种方式简化了硬件的复杂性,但也可能存在一些由虚拟化技术引起的问题,如与宿主操作系统的资源竞争等,在选择虚拟化部署时,应仔细考量其对应用性能的可能影响。

归纳而言,配置Linux服务器是一个全面的过程,涉及硬件选择、操作系统安装、网络配置、软件管理及日常维护等多个方面,每一步骤都需要计划和注意,以确保服务器能够高效、安全地服务于最终用户,理解并遵循这些基本的配置原则,将帮助确保服务器的稳定运行和快速响应。

FAQs

如何在Linux下高效配置服务器?(图片来源网络,侵删)

Q1: 如何选择合适的Linux发行版?

A1: 选择Linux发行版时,考虑因素包括系统的稳定性、安全性、软件支持和社区活跃度,Ubuntu适合初学者和需要大量软件支持的服务器,而CentOS则以其稳定性和安全性被许多企业级应用所青睐。

Q2: 如何确保Linux服务器的安全?

A2: 确保Linux服务器的安全可以通过以下方式实现:定期更新系统和应用软件来修补安全漏洞,配置好防火墙规则以阻止未授权访问,使用加密方式管理密码和敏感数据,以及安装入侵检测系统来监控异常行为。


如何在Linux下高效配置服务器?(图片来源网络,侵删)

相关内容

热门资讯

裸辞做“一人公司”,我后悔了 去年这个时候,一位以色列程序员正在东南亚旅行。他顺手把一个在脑子里转了很久的想法做成了产品,一个让任...
南京建成国内首个Pre-6G试... 4月21日,2026全球6G技术与产业生态大会在南京开幕。全息互动技术展台前,一名远在北京的工作人员...
超梵求职受邀参加“2025抖音... 超梵求职受邀参加“2025抖音巨量引擎成人教育行业生态大会”,探讨分享优质内容传播,服务万千学员。 ...
摩托罗拉Razr 2026(R... IT之家 4 月 22 日消息,摩托罗拉宣布新一代 Razr 折叠手机将于 4 月 29 日在美国发...
库克卸任,特纳斯领航:苹果新纪... 苹果首席执行官蒂姆·库克将卸任,硬件工程主管约翰·特纳斯将接任,苹果公司今天宣布此事。 库克将在夏季...